Frequently Asked Questions about Columbia
How much are Studio apartments in Columbia?
There are currently 14 Studio Apartments in Columbia with rent ranges from $1,709 to $2,279 with an average price of $1,900.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Columbia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Columbia ranges from $489 to $3,150 with an average monthly rent of $1,926.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Columbia c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Columbia range from $586 to $5,673.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,241.
How expensive are Columbia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 60 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Columbia on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$677 to $4,575 - averaging $2,755 for the location.
